Как устроены платформы обработки событий в реальном времени

Как устроены платформы обработки событий в реальном времени

Механизмы обработки инцидентов в реальном времени представляют собой комплекс софтверных модулей, которые принимают, исследуют и обрабатывают массивы данных с незначительной отсрочкой. Такие комплексы работают постоянно, предоставляя немедленную ответ на приходящую данные.

Базу структуры формируют три ключевых компонента: источники происшествий, обработчики и репозитории данных. Источники создают непрестанный поток сведений через специальные каналы. Обработчики реализуют отбор, трансформацию и объединение данных согласно указанным принципам.

Современные системы эксплуатируют децентрализованную архитектуру для гарантирования высокой скорости. Поступающие инциденты распределяются между множеством узлов обработки, что позволяет 1хбет расширяться горизонтально и обслуживать миллионы инцидентов в секунду.

Важнейшим критерием выступает время реакции — промежуток между приемом происшествия и формированием ответа. Эффективные решения обслуживают информацию за миллисекунды, что существенно для экономических переводов и комплексов защиты.

Источники событий: сенсоры, сервисы, логи, транзакции и пользовательские действия

Происшествия попадают в комплекс из разнообразных источников, каждый из которых производит особый формат данных. Сенсоры производственного техники передают показатели температуры, давления, вибрации и прочих физических характеристик с частотой до сотен измерений в секунду.

Веб-приложения и мобильные службы формируют события при взаимодействии пользователя с интерфейсом. Щелчки, посещения страниц, добавление изделий генерируют непрестанный последовательность активности. Серверные программы регистрируют обращения к API и корректировки состояния подключений.

Системные логи регистрируют технические инциденты: ошибки, уведомления, информационные оповещения о деятельности структуры. Специальные модули получают записи с серверов и контейнеров, передавая их в 1xbet казино для централизованной обработки.

Экономические операции создают критически значимые происшествия при переводах и оплатах. Банковские системы генерируют записи о каждой операции с картой и модификации счета. Биржевые системы фиксируют запросы на закупку и продажу активов.

Архитектура поточной преобразования

Непрерывная преобразование строится на основе беспрерывного потока данных через последовательность модулей без промежуточного фиксации. События следуют через последовательность изменений, где каждый элемент производит заданную операцию: фильтрацию, дополнение, агрегацию или маршрутизацию.

Фундаментальная структура охватывает ярус получения данных, который получает события из внешних источников и преобразует их в унифицированный формат. Следующий ярус производит бизнес-логику: рассчитывает метрики, находит аномалии, использует нормы обработки. Итоги поступают в уровень отдачи для сохранения или транспортировки.

Современные решения обеспечивают два варианта к обработке. Первый обрабатывает каждое происшествие персонально моментально после приема. Второй группирует инциденты в небольшие порции и обслуживает их с шагом в несколько секунд. Определение определяется от критериев к отсрочке и количеству данных.

Компоненты архитектуры коммуницируют через унифицированные соединения, что обеспечивает подменять определенные элементы без изменения всей системы. 1хбет казино предоставляет пластичность при корректировке условий.

Очереди и шины данных: как события отправляются между службами

Передача инцидентов между частями структуры выполняется через специализированные механизмы передачи уведомлениями. Очереди сообщений обеспечивают надёжную передачу данных от производителей к получателям с гарантией целостности при неполадках.

Магистрали данных представляют собой децентрализованные платформы для публикации и подписки на последовательности событий. Производители направляют уведомления в именованные каналы, а адресаты регистрируются на требуемые категории. Такая схема дает отдельному происшествию доходить совокупности адресатов одновременно.

Ключевые параметры механизмов отправки событий содержат:

  • Пропускную производительность — объем уведомлений в единицу времени
  • Отсрочку передачи — время между передачей и принятием
  • Гарантии транспортировки — показатель устойчивости передачи
  • Очередность — удержание очередности происшествий

Средства кэширования аккумулируют происшествия при кратковременной недоступности получателей. 1xbet казино сохраняет данные на накопителе до момента успешной преобразования. Репликация между узлами исключает потерю информации при отказе машин.

Варианты обслуживания

Системы реального времени используют разнообразные модели обработки инцидентов в обусловленности от бизнес-требований и характера данных. Каждая вариант определяет вариант объединения, изучения и трансформации входящих потоков.

Преобразование отдельных инцидентов исследует каждое сообщение независимо от остальных. Платформа применяет правила фильтрации и дополнения к каждой строке моментально после приема. Такой вариант уменьшает задержки и годится для критичных случаев с необходимостью быстрой отклика.

Временная обработка собирает происшествия по хронологическим промежуткам или объему строк. Система аккумулирует данные в продолжение конкретного промежутка, далее реализует объединение и расчет показателей. Окна могут быть статичными, подвижными или сессионными в связи от правил сервиса.

Преобразование с удержанием положения сохраняет связь между событиями. Платформа сохраняет временные данные, регистраторы, сохраненные данные для следующих операций. 1иксбет применяет децентрализованное базу для обеспечения согласованности. Подход без состояния обслуживает события автономно, что упрощает расширение.

Размещение данных: оперативные (real-time) и архивные (архивные) слои

Архитектура хранения данных в механизмах реального времени сегментируется на несколько ярусов в обусловленности от периодичности обращения и критериев к быстроте чтения. Такое сегментация оптимизирует затраты и предоставляет компромисс между эффективностью и стоимостью.

Активный ярус включает текущие информацию, к которым нужен мгновенный доступ. Сведения размещается в временной памяти или на быстрых SSD-дисках для минимизации времени реакции. Базы этого слоя обслуживают тысячи вызовов в секунду. Срок сохранения составляет от нескольких часов до нескольких дней.

Буферный уровень содержит данные промежуточного возраста для исследования и формирования отчетов. События перемещаются сюда самостоятельно после окончания времени свежести. 1хбет казино гарантирует равновесие между быстротой запроса и количеством хранения.

Долгосрочный архивный слой служит для длительного размещения старых сведений. Данные помещается на экономичных дисках с замедленным обращением. Хранилища задействуются для удовлетворения условиям контролеров, ревизии и исследования тенденций. Интервал сохранения может доходить нескольких лет.

Увеличение и надежность

Возможность механизма обрабатывать увеличивающиеся количества данных и удерживать работоспособность при авариях формирует её надёжность в промышленной условиях. Построение должна содержать механизмы горизонтального расширения и резервирования важных модулей.

Горизонтальное увеличение добавляет свежие компоненты обработки при росте загрузки. События самостоятельно разделяются между готовыми узлами в соответствии методам выравнивания. Механизм оперативно подстраивается к изменению потока данных без паузы.

Средства достижения устойчивости 1xbet казино содержат:

  • Копирование данных между серверами для предупреждения исчезновений
  • Автоматическое перенаправление на дублирующие компоненты при сбое
  • Промежуточные снимки для сохранения положения обработки
  • Возобновление с продолжением с финального зафиксированного статуса

Распределение трафика осуществляется на базе ключей партиционирования, которые определяют направление происшествий к модулям. 1иксбет обеспечивает последовательную преобразование связанных инцидентов на единственном узле. Контроль работоспособности узлов позволяет обнаруживать ухудшение эффективности и переназначать операции.

Мониторинг и оповещение: как отслеживают положение массивов и реагируют на отклонения

Непрерывное отслеживание за статусом платформы обработки инцидентов позволяет определять проблемы до их существенного влияния на бизнес-процессы. Средства мониторинга собирают параметры эффективности и генерируют предупреждения при отклонениях от нормальных величин.

Ключевые метрики охватывают интенсивность приема инцидентов, латентность обработки, длину очередей и количество сбоев. Комплексы следят занятость процессоров, использование памяти и дискового объема на серверах системы. Схемы отображают изменение величин в реальном времени.

Граничные значения задают лимиты обычного работы для каждой параметра. При выходе лимитов платформа самостоятельно генерирует оповещения для специалистов. 1хбет казино обеспечивает конфигурировать принципы оповещения с учётом значимости различных видов происшествий.

Исследование аномалий использует статистические приемы для определения нестандартных закономерностей в последовательностях данных. Процедуры находят стремительные всплески загрузки, аномальные цепочки событий, подозрительную активность. Самостоятельные реакции включают увеличение мощностей, смену на дублирующие пути или ограничение приходящего трафика.

Образцы задействования комплексов обработки событий

Экономические институты используют системы обработки происшествий для выявления мошеннических транзакций. Процедуры исследуют каждую операцию по карте в instant выполнения, сопоставляя с историческими шаблонами активности заказчика. При выявлении сомнительной поведения система прерывает операцию за миллисекунды.

Онлайн-магазины задействуют непрерывную обработку для персонализации рекомендаций товаров. События посещения страниц, добавления в список и покупок обслуживаются в реальном времени. Платформа создает современные предложения на фундаменте актуального действий пользователя.

Индустриальные заводы внедряют наблюдение устройств для упреждающего ремонта. Измерители на производственных конвейерах передают данные колебаний, температуры и потребления электричества. 1иксбет изучает данные и предсказывает возможные поломки, что обеспечивает готовить ремонт без непредвиденных прерываний.

Перевозочные фирмы наблюдают транспортировку грузов и оптимизируют пути транспортировки. GPS-трекеры производят позиции перевозочных автомобилей каждые несколько секунд. Платформа рассматривает заторы и приоритетность заказов для оперативной модификации путей и уведомления клиентов о времени приезда.